Beautiful pair of 210 hickory ligno Eggen racing skis from the early 1970s. Tops have been cleaned and protected with a shiny coat of urethane. You want camber? I got your camber RIGHT HERE!!! Springy skis with race ready restored bases. Eggen skis were a product of the Engerdal Skifabrikk in eastern Norway. The skis were named in honor of Gjermund Eggen, hero of the 1966 Nordic World
